Mental Unknotting

Abstract: 21 subjects were given a series of spatial test items involving the comparison of diagrams of interlaced ropes or knots at varying orientations. Knots were chosen because they are deformable and the manipulative tasks form a contrast to previous work on rigid objects and also because there is a mathematical structure to the study of their properties. “…In a study of the strategies for performing spatial tasks, McLeay and Piggins (1998) carried out an experiment which used novel stimuli. These were nonrigid deformable structures depicted as looped ropes which were either knotted or not.…”
